LED Emergency Panel Light for Office 90■LED Emergency Panel Light UGR
The LED emergency panel light for office 90■ is designed to meet the stringent requirements of office environments. These lights are engineered to provide uniform illumination across the workspace, ensuring that employees can navigate safely during power outages. The UGR rating of these lights is a crucial factor, as it measures the potential for glare and discomfort. A lower UGR rating indicates a more comfortable lighting environment, which is particularly important in office settings where visual comfort and productivity are paramount.
LED emergency panel lights with a UGR of 19 or lower are considered to have a high level of visual comfort. This is achieved through precise control of the light distribution and color temperature, which helps to reduce eye strain and maintain visual acuity. LED Emergency Panel Light for Cleanroom
Cleanrooms are highly controlled environments where the presence of dust and contaminants can compromise the quality of products. The LED emergency panel light for cleanroom is specifically designed to meet the stringent cleanliness and performance requirements of these facilities. These lights are engineered to emit minimal heat and produce minimal dust, ensuring that they do not contribute to the contamination of the cleanroom environment.
Moreover, the LED emergency panel light for cleanroom is often equipped with a UGR of 19 or lower, providing a comfortable lighting environment for workers. The light distribution is designed to minimize shadows and reflections, which are common issues in cleanrooms. This ensures that employees can work efficiently without the risk of errors due to poor visibility.
